Handover note – seed samples, Ellery trial plot

Tomas,

The six sample tins of Norvane barley seed are sealed, labelled by lot, and sitting in the cool store by the dispatch desk. Paperwork is in the green folder taped to the top tin; the trial coordinator at Ellery Farm needs it signed on arrival. Greenlark Couriers are booked for Wednesday morning. Keep the tins out of direct sun and don't break the lot seals for any reason. The confidential courier hand-over instruction is below.

handover note for yagef-bagep: the drudor pelius courier leaves the kasdor zorvan norir ledger at gate 8016 under passcode 755406

Handover note for the incoming contractor on Soundvane. The waveform preview service generates peak data asynchronously after upload; the player polls until it's ready, so a blank waveform for a few seconds is expected, not a bug. Peaks are stored per-resolution, and regeneration is idempotent — safe to re-run. Mira left the resampler alone last sprint; don't touch it without a load test. The preview worker starts with the configuration listed below.

config for kafof-bawef:
holath:
  log_level: debug
  metrics_host: metrics.holath.qorvelsys.internal
  pin: 2191
  pool_size: 32

Subject: DR drill — Stagesight seat-map renderer

Team, next Thursday we will run the quarterly disaster-recovery drill for the Stagesight seat-map renderer. We will fail over rendering to the Ashdale standby cluster, verify seat-hold integrity, and measure redraw latency throughout. Please review the drill plan beforehand. To restore the primary render cache afterward, enter the passphrase provided below.

unlock words, hahip-baduf: holwyn-istath-julvan

## Limits and Quotas: Ledgerloom Inventory Reconciliation

The nightly reconciliation job in Ledgerloom compares warehouse counts against the Pallet Registry and writes correction events in batches. To keep lock contention low on the registry shards, the job enforces hard caps on batch size, concurrent shard scans, and retry depth. Exceeding any cap pauses the run rather than degrading peers. Current tuning constants are listed below.

tuning table, fawip-fahag:
WEIGHTS = {
    "novwyn": 452,
    "casdor": 675,
}